STATE SWIMMING CHAMPIONSHIPS: Red Devils’ Dant sets record in 500 freestyle, repeats as 1A-2A champ

HobbsDailyReport.com CARY — Newton-Conover High’s Ross Dant highlighted finishes by local swimmers over the weekend as he repeated as the state’s best in the 500-meter freestyle in the state 1A-2A meet. Dant set a classification and state record — finishing in a time of four minutes, 18.70 seconds — and added a second-place finish in the 100 backstroke in 49.16. …

HIGH SCHOOLS: Newton-Conover dedicates bleachers in memory of late principal

HobbsDailyReport.com NEWTON – Newton-Conover High has dedicated new bleachers in its gym in memory of the late Kevin Campbell, who served the school for 22 years as a teacher, athletic trainer, assistant principal and principal.
